About Baja Broadband
Baja Broadband is a company based in Fort Mill (United States) founded in 2006 was acquired by TDS Telecom in February 2013. Baja Broadband operates in a competitive market with competitors including 1&1 IONOS, Vonage, Viatel, Aureon and Dialog Axiata, among others.

Telecommunications services are offered to businesses in Mexico, including high-speed Internet access, digital television programming, and digital phone features such as call waiting, forwarding, and caller ID. These services are delivered through a fiber-optic platform, focusing on broadband, voice, and video sectors within the region.
